<b>Maker:</b> Kamenický Šenov</br></br> This original six-arm pendant chandelier called Sputnik, originating from the 1960s, represents an iconic and highly valued example of Czechoslovak design production by the manufacturer Kamenický Šenov, carrying the unmistakable spirit of the Mid-Century style. The visual appearance of the fixture is primarily defined by a precisely crafted structure made of professionally cleaned chromed steel, characterized by high gloss, elegance, and absolute cleanliness of detail. This metal structure is ingeniously fitted with six opaline glass shades. The entire design reflects the space age and innovative approach of the time, while placing maximum emphasis on clean lines, purposefulness, and visual lightness.</br></br>The item has undergone a complete, highly professional, and sensitive renovation carried out with the utmost regard for preserving original authenticity. The brand-new electrical wiring was executed in absolute compliance with applicable safety regulations and technical standards. An integral part of this professional care was also the detailed revision and maintenance of six lamp sockets designed for E14 type bulbs, thereby fully guaranteeing one-hundred-percent operational safety and reliable functionality.
